For the last time, I will repeat.
You are only talking about layout and display but never ever you have
talked about the accounting moves and the tax reports.
So we can only guess that indeed there is no differences on this topic
and so for me, you can solve the issue by using different journals and
customize the numbering base on the journal.

PS: Many localization has required different numbering option for the
invoice. I'm pretty sure a generic solution should be to use the
MatchMixin pattern with a list on the fiscalyear.
